It should: Summarize the main themes of the presentation, Leave the audience with a specific and noteworthy takeaway (i.e. propose a specific course of action), and. Include a statement that allows the speaker to leave the podium (or pass the mic) gracefully.
Thank you for your time/attention. I hope you found this presentation informative/useful/insightful. Remember: the last words you say should make it abundantly clear that your presentation has ended.
The last slide is called the closing slide, and thiscanbe your thank you slide. But if you feel an alternative slide is more appropriate, then you can close your presentation with many other options. As you can see, good PowerPoint presentations are more complicated than they seem.
What should be the last slide of a presentation? The last slide of a presentation should be a conclusion slide, summarizing key takeaways, delivering a strong closing statement and possibly including a call to action.
Drive Your Main Points Home There is a simple summary formula that many professional speakers use in the ending slide: Tell them what you are going to tell them. Tell them. Then, tell them what you told them.
Outline view in PowerPoint displays your presentation as an outline made up of the titles and main text from each slide. Each title appears on the left side of the pane that contains the Outline tab, along with a slide icon and slide number. The main text is indented under the slide title.
Your concluding slides serve as parting thoughts that may linger through the minds of the audience. This may further compel them to revisit the core messages that youre aiming to convey through your presentation.
A presentation outline refers to the barebones version of a talk or a speech that summarizes the main points and takes the general direction of the pitch. It allows presenters to structure the flow of information in a manner that is easy to understand. Without an outline, your presentation can be a nightmare.
